Payroll Administrator (Part Time)
Job Summary
The Role
As a Payroll Administrator you will play a key role in ensuring the accurate and timely processing of payroll for over 1000 employees. Working closely with the Payroll & Benefits Manager you will contribute to a reliable and customer-focused payroll function while supporting benefits administration and ongoing process improvements.
The role is offered on a part time basis of 25 hours per week to be worked over 5 days with 2 days per week in the office.
Key Responsibilities
- Support the accurate and timely processing of monthly payroll including starters leavers and contractual changes
- Administer statutory payments pensions and employee benefits in line with UK legislation
- Validate payroll data carry out checks and support reconciliations and reporting
- Maintain accurate records and ensure compliance with GDPR and company policies
- Respond to payroll queries and collaborate with internal teams and external providers
- Contribute to annual reward processes and continuous improvement of payroll practices
Qualifications :
- Previous payroll experience with a solid understanding of UK payroll legislation
- Strong attention to detail accuracy and organisational skills
- Confident using Excel and payroll/HR systems
- Effective communicator with a customer-focused approach
- Discreet proactive and committed to continuous improvement
(CIPP qualification or willingness to study towards one is advantageous.)
